<paragraph id="AD4636F3FFE149221DB9FC4DFD65229F" blockId="9.[151,1437,1425,2028]" pageId="9" pageNumber="530">Anophthalmous, depigmented, body concolourously reddish-brown, but head and pronotum slightly darker. Surface glabrous on dorsum, microsculpture consisting of isodiametric meshes on head, transverse striations on pronotum and elytra. Moderately convex on dorsum.</paragraph>
<paragraph id="AD4636F3FFE149211DB9FCF1FBB324AD" blockId="9.[151,1437,1425,2028]" lastBlockId="10.[151,1437,150,250]" lastPageId="10" lastPageNumber="531" pageId="9" pageNumber="530">
Head subquadrate, eyes absent, longer than wide, widest at about middle, HLm/HW = 2.83.0, HLl/HW = 1.5 1.6; frontal furrows complete and well-marked, strongly divergent posteriorly; anterior pairs of supraorbital pores at about half and the posterior at the ending points of frontal furrows respectively; clypeus quadrisetose; labrum 6- setose; right mandible well-developed, tridentate though median one is weak; labial suture completely disappeared; mentum bisetose on either side of tooth base, widely and deeply concave at basal area; tooth short but broad, bifid at tip; submentum with a row of 10 setae; ligula thick and short, 8-setose at apex, inner two much stouter and longer than other; palps elongate, all glabrous but 2

<paragraph id="AD4636F3FFE349201DB9FAB3FD312549" blockId="11.[151,1437,151,285]" pageId="11" pageNumber="532">Pronotum wider than head, PW/HW = 1.21.3, almost as long as wide, widest about middle, base slightly narrower than front, PbW/PfW = 0.860.88; lateral margins narrowly reflexed upwards throughout, suddenly sinuate just before hind angles which is obtuse, fore angles protruding; anterior and posterior latero-marginal setae at frontal 1/6 and at hind angles of pronotum respectively.</paragraph>

<paragraph id="AD4636F3FFE449271DB9FB6FFDDD25DD" blockId="12.[151,1437,150,789]" pageId="12" pageNumber="533">Abdominal ventrites sparsely setose; ventrites IVVI each with a pair of paramedial setae, VII bisetose apically in male, whereas quadrisetose in female.</paragraph>

<paragraph id="AD4636F3FFE449271DB9F897FC5B2741" blockId="12.[151,1437,150,789]" pageId="12" pageNumber="533">
The cave Qizimei Dong is at about
<quantity id="6A019B16FFE449271F2BF897FD0C2699" box="[597,654,691,717]" metricMagnitude="3" metricUnit="m" metricValue="4.0" pageId="12" pageNumber="533" unit="km" value="4.0">4 km</quantity>
from Chunmuyun Town to the west and remains in good natural condition. Its length is unknown. All the beetles were collected in the dark zone not far from the entrance, most found under the stone but one running on the wall of the main passage (
